The Urology Medical Assistant assists with office procedures as directed by physicians, taking vitals, draw blood (phlebotomy), handles lab telephone calls, and more at The Essentials Center. This role serves as a liaison between the patients, physicians/providers, and other staff members.

Established in 1982 by three oncologists, Augusta Oncology quickly became the leading community oncology clinic within the CSRA. Over the last 40 years, our physicians recognized the health needs of our community go far beyond that of oncology and hematology so to better serve all patients, Augusta Oncology expanded to offer multiple specialties and became AO Multispecialty Clinic. As the first multispecialty clinic of its kind in the CSRA, we are proud to offer oncology, hematology, gynecological oncology, internal medicine, plastic surgery, urology, urogynecology and rheumatology services.
